Transaction ab3108587b379874c2bb5f04a8087656585dd27c1684c38eb2adf09d00d9d358
1 Input
2 Outputs
- ab3108587b379874c2bb5f04a8087656585dd27c1684c38eb2adf09d00d9d358:0
- ab3108587b379874c2bb5f04a8087656585dd27c1684c38eb2adf09d00d9d358:1
value 36789656
address 16YJtq4XTXFtFSJpG4PnE7R3bZgfw3hSvz
value 16700
address 11465nCPfr2wazsDf7NE7KSepKGjX2NKAa